In this episode of Essence and Essentials, Jasmine Looi speaks with music teacher, jazz director, and photographer Jason Li about the role of creativity in improving mental health and overall quality of life. Drawing from his work with elementary students and young musicians in Nashville, Jason shares how music fosters connection, emotional expression, and collaboration—often functioning as its own universal language. The conversation also explores improvisation, the importance of listening, and how creative practices like music and photography can cultivate flow, curiosity, and mindfulness. Together, they reflect on how creativity, curiosity, and meaningful work can contribute to a more fulfilling and healthy life.
